Porsche unveiled its Macan EV today, bringing its second all-electric car to market and releasing some interesting details regarding its performance and power. Ten years after the launch of the Macan, Porsche is bringing the vehicle in what it calls “a bold new direction.”

Porsche has officially dedicated a new engine plant for eight-cylinder engines. Porsche’s new engine plant will also contribute towards synergies within the Volkswagen Group.
